Smart projectors combine traditional projection technology with built-in streaming capabilities, essentially putting a full entertainment system in a single device. Instead of connecting a separate Roku, Apple TV, or gaming console, everything runs directly on the projector itself.
The key technical specifications that determine your viewing experience include ANSI lumens (a standardized measurement of brightness), native resolution (the actual pixel count the projector displays), and light source type (LED, laser, or traditional lamp). But beyond the spec sheet, factors like audio quality, smart platform capabilities, and setup convenience can make or break your daily experience.

The most fundamental difference between these projectors lies in their display technology. The Epson EF22 uses 3LCD technology with a laser light source, while the Aurzen BOOM 3 employs TFT LCD with LED lighting. Understanding this distinction is crucial for making an informed choice.
3LCD technology uses three separate liquid crystal panels—one each for red, green, and blue light—which are then combined to create the final image. This approach, pioneered by Epson, provides excellent color accuracy and avoids the "rainbow effect" (brief flashes of color) that some people notice with competing DLP (Digital Light Processing) projectors that use spinning color wheels.
The EF22 produces 1,000 ANSI lumens, exactly double the BOOM 3's 500 ANSI lumens. In practical terms, this means the Epson can create a usable image in brighter rooms and maintain image quality on larger screens. During my testing, I found that 500-lumen projectors like the BOOM 3 work well in dedicated dark rooms or for evening viewing, but struggle when ambient light is present.
The laser light source in the EF22 offers several advantages over the LED system in the BOOM 3. Laser diodes maintain consistent brightness over their 20,000-hour lifespan, while LEDs gradually dim over time. More importantly, laser systems can achieve higher peak brightness while maintaining color accuracy—something that becomes crucial when displaying HDR (High Dynamic Range) content with its expanded brightness and color ranges.
Both projectors support native 1080p resolution with 4K decoding, meaning they can accept 4K signals but display them at 1080p. For screen sizes under 100 inches, this resolution provides sharp, detailed images that satisfy most viewers. The BOOM 3 actually supports larger screen sizes up to 250 inches, though image quality becomes less impressive at these extreme sizes.
Color accuracy represents another significant difference. The EF22's 3LCD system with laser illumination produces more vibrant, true-to-life colors. Professional reviews consistently note the Epson's superior color gamut—the range of colors it can display—compared to LED-based projectors. However, the BOOM 3 still delivers surprisingly good color reproduction for its price point, with reviewers praising its out-of-the-box color balance.
Here's where the Aurzen BOOM 3 absolutely dominates. With 36 watts of total power distributed across four speakers in a 2.2 channel configuration, it produces audio that rivals dedicated soundbars costing hundreds of dollars. The system includes two full-range drivers and two tweeters (high-frequency speakers), plus advanced DSP (Digital Signal Processing) technology that prevents distortion even at high volumes.
I've tested the BOOM 3's audio extensively, and it genuinely surprised me. The bass response is substantial enough for action movies, while dialogue remains clear and centered. The 3D Dolby Audio processing creates an immersive soundstage that makes you forget you're listening to built-in projector speakers.
The Epson EF22 takes a more conventional approach with dual 5-watt speakers totaling 10 watts. While these speakers include Dolby Audio processing and sound quality is respectable for their size, they simply cannot compete with the BOOM 3's more powerful system. Most users will want to connect external speakers or a soundbar to the EF22 for optimal audio performance.
This audio difference has real implications for setup and cost. The BOOM 3 can serve as your complete entertainment system, while the EF22 may require additional audio equipment, increasing the total system cost and complexity.
Both projectors run custom smart TV platforms, but with different approaches and capabilities. The BOOM 3 uses Aurzen's proprietary Smart ZenOS, which provides direct access to major streaming services including Netflix, Prime Video, and YouTube. Having officially licensed apps matters because it ensures reliable performance and regular updates—something that plagued early smart projectors with unofficial app installations.
The EF22 runs Google TV, which offers access to over 10,000 streaming apps and includes Google Assistant voice control. This represents a more comprehensive smart TV experience with better long-term support prospects. Google TV's interface is particularly good at content discovery, suggesting shows and movies across multiple services.
Both systems support wireless casting from smartphones and tablets, though the EF22's Google Cast implementation tends to be more reliable than the BOOM 3's proprietary system. For users who primarily stream content, both platforms handle the essential services well, but the EF22 provides more flexibility and features.
Modern smart projectors have revolutionized setup with automatic adjustment technologies. Both the BOOM 3 and EF22 feature auto-focus systems that use sensors and motors to maintain sharp images without manual adjustment. The BOOM 3 uses a 9-directional gyroscope system for particularly responsive focus adjustments.
Keystone correction automatically adjusts the image shape when the projector is placed at an angle to the screen. The BOOM 3 offers 6D keystone correction, meaning it can adjust the image in six different directions to create a perfect rectangle even when positioned off-center or tilted. The EF22 provides similar automatic geometry correction through Epson's EpiqSense technology.
I've found these automatic features work reliably about 90% of the time, with occasional manual fine-tuning needed for perfect results. The convenience factor is enormous compared to older projectors that required extensive manual adjustment.
The EF22 includes a distinctive 360-degree rotating stand that allows for ceiling projection and unusual mounting angles. This flexibility is particularly useful for apartment dwellers who can't install ceiling mounts. The BOOM 3 offers more traditional mounting options but includes features like digital zoom (50-100% sizing without moving the projector) that add setup flexibility.

For dedicated home theater use, both projectors have strengths but serve different scenarios. The BOOM 3 excels in apartment or smaller home situations where you want maximum impact from a single device. Its powerful audio system creates an immersive experience that works well for movie nights, gaming, and casual viewing.
The EF22 better suits users building a more serious home theater setup. Its superior brightness allows for larger screens and some ambient lighting, while the laser technology provides the color accuracy serious movie enthusiasts appreciate. However, you'll likely want to invest in separate audio equipment to match the visual quality.
Screen size considerations also matter for home theater use. While the BOOM 3 technically supports screens up to 250 inches, image quality degrades significantly above 120 inches. The EF22 maintains better performance at its maximum 150-inch size, though both projectors work best in the 80-120 inch range for optimal picture quality.
The brightness difference between these projectors becomes critical in different environments. The EF22's 1,000 lumens allows for usable images with some ambient lighting—perfect for family rooms where you might want lights dimmed but not completely off. The BOOM 3 requires darker conditions for optimal viewing, making it better suited for evening use or dedicated viewing spaces.
Portability represents another key difference. The BOOM 3 weighs about a pound less and includes more robust connectivity options (dual HDMI and USB ports), making it easier to move between locations for outdoor movie nights or presentations. The EF22 feels more premium but less portable for frequent transport.
